Take a stroll outside from time to time. Fresh air is good for everyone and staying active helps you relax. As you walk around take note of the things that seem to aggravate your tinnitus. Maybe cars or trucks passing by make it worse, for example. Write down each trigger, and do what you can to avoid encountering those triggers. Give yourself no more than a 15 minute window to fall asleep at night. If you’re still awake, get up out of bed and go elsewhere in your home. Don’t do anything that will stress you out or keep you awake. This isn’t the time to start on large projects such as cleaning the garage. Simply find a relaxing activity to pursue. TRT therapy focuses on the task of making the ringing sensation more tolerable. TRT helps you change your perception about the noises caused by tinnitus. You can simply train yourself to see tinnitus as a “non-issue”. In that way, you can put your attention on more important matters.
When your tinnitus prevents you from concentrating on your work, listen to music. Instrumental music is relaxing and provides white noise that won’t interfere with your concentration. If your tinnitus gets worse when you exercise, find exercises that are less strenuous for your body.
